Immunohistochemistry (Formalin/PFA-fixed paraffin-embedded sections) - Anti-Estrogen Receptor alpha (mutated Y537S + D538G) antibody [EPR28709-35] (AB316764)
Immunohistochemical analysis of paraffin-embedded (A) HEK-293T (human embryonic kidney epithelial cell) transfected with a human ERα (Y537S, D538G) expression vector containing a His tag. (B) HEK-293T transfected with a human ERα (Y537S) expression vector containing a His tag. (C) HEK-293T transfected with a human ERα (D538G) expression vector containing a His tag. (D) HEK-293T transfected with a human ERα expression vector containing a His tag. (E) HEK-293T transfected with empty vector containing a His tag. tissue labeling Estrogen Receptor alpha (mutated Y537S + D538G) with ab316764 at 1/2000 (0.266 ug/ml) dilution, followed by a ready to use LeicaDS9800 (Bond™ Polymer Refine Detection).
Positive staining on 293T overexpressing (A) human ERα (Y537S, D538G). No staining on 293T overexpressing human (B) ERα (Y537S), (C) ERα (D538G), (D) wild-type ERα, or (E) the empty vector control.
The section was incubated with ab316764 for 30 mins at room temperature.
The immunostaining was performed on a Leica Biosystems BOND® RX instrument
Counterstained with Hematoxylin.
Secondary antibody only control : Secondary antibody is a ready to use LeicaDS9800 (Bond™ Polymer Refine Detection).
Heat mediated antigen retrieval was performed with Tris-EDTA buffer (pH 9.0, Epitope Retrieval Solution2) for 20 mins

Biological function summary
ERα plays a significant role in the regulation of estrogen signaling. Estrogens binding to ERα activate the receptor which can form a homodimer or heterodimer complex with other proteins like coactivators or corepressors. This complex then modulates the transcription of genes involved in cell growth proliferation and differentiation. ERα is closely linked with processes like reproductive tissue development and maintenance.
Pathways
ERα is involved in the estrogen signaling pathway and the cell cycle regulation pathway. In the estrogen signaling pathway ERα works together with proteins such as coactivators which enhance gene transcription and corepressors which can inhibit transcription. In the context of cell cycle regulation ERα's interactions with other cell cycle proteins help control cell division and proliferation linking ERα activity to the progression through different stages of the cell cycle.
